Over the summer, I interned with Houston Public Works on the Multimodal Safety and Design team, which focuses on roadway safety, climate resilience, and equitable accessibility. I contributed to projects such as a tree canopy analysis for roadways, a light rail line proposal, and the design of a mini park. These projects allowed me to apply tools like GIS for data-driven planning, InDesign and Photoshop for public-facing reports, and SketchUp for visualizing design concepts.
Through this experience, I discovered a passion for equitable, community centered urban design that is both sustainable and practical. My favorite moments were collaborating with my team sharing ideas, refining proposals, and creating unified visions that serve the people of Houston. This internship strengthened my technical skills, deepened my interest in urban design, and confirmed my aspiration to pursue a career where design directly improves quality of life.
